Subject[PATCH 30/32] perf, x86: Add a Haswell precise instructions event v2
Date
From: Andi Kleen <ak@linux.intel.com>

Add a instructions-p event alias that uses the PDIR randomized instruction
retirement event. This is useful to avoid some systematic sampling shadow
problems. Normally PEBS sampling has a systematic shadow. With PDIR
enabled the hardware adds some randomization that statistically avoids
this problem. In this sense, it's more precise over a whole sampling
interval, but an individual sample can be less precise. But since we
sample overall it's a more precise event.

This could be used before using the explicit event code syntax, but it's easier
and more user friendly to use with an "instructions-p" alias. I expect
this will eventually become a common use case.

Right now for Haswell, will add to Ivy Bridge later too.

arch/x86/kernel/cpu/perf_event_intel.c | 2 ++
1 files changed, 2 insertions(+), 0 deletions(-)

diff --git a/arch/x86/kernel/cpu/perf_event_intel.c b/arch/x86/kernel/cpu/perf_event_intel.c
index e8fb4e2..d177d88 100644
--- a/arch/x86/kernel/cpu/perf_event_intel.c
+++ b/arch/x86/kernel/cpu/perf_event_intel.c
@@ -2033,6 +2033,7 @@ EVENT_ATTR_STR(cycles-t, cycles_t, "event=0x3c,intx=1");
EVENT_ATTR_STR(cycles-ct, cycles_ct, "event=0x3c,intx=1,intx_cp=1");
EVENT_ATTR_STR(instructions-t, instructions_t, "event=0xc0,intx=1");
EVENT_ATTR_STR(instructions-ct,instructions_ct,"event=0xc0,intx=1,intx_cp=1");
+EVENT_ATTR_STR(instructions-p, instructions_p, "event=0xc0,umask=0x01,precise=2");

static struct attribute *hsw_events_attrs[] = {
EVENT_PTR(tx_start),
@@ -2053,6 +2054,7 @@ static struct attribute *hsw_events_attrs[] = {
EVENT_PTR(cycles_ct),
EVENT_PTR(instructions_t),
EVENT_PTR(instructions_ct),
+ EVENT_PTR(instructions_p),
NULL
};
